Okay. Got the solution now. Open settings then applications, then all aps, and then force stop and clear data of the app media storage. Then restart. And it should be fine.

While rooting you must not have cleared data. For that, the data of GB media refresh was persistent in your SD card. And the new media refresh was using the older data causing all the mess up. Now that you cleared the data, things have started all over again. The creation of thumbnails for gallery, etc etc.
So, now when you delete a pic, the thumbnail will get deleted automatically.

Look for and delete a file named .nomedia from the base of which ever card you have these images or music on. I heard that this was something a ROM Manager update did.

Well I kinda figured out what's going on with the Gallery. It appears that a media scan won't show media already existing on the device. However, if you take a picture it will show the new pic in the gallery correctly. I've also verified that I have no .nomedia files.
I'm guessing that when a photo is taken it explicitly adds an entry to the media table, but there is a problem when a full scan is triggered which makes the gallery blank.
